On September 1st, Israeli special forces carried out the kidnapping of a senior security official in Hamas, Mounir al-Arabiid, in the area west of Gaza City. The operation took more than a week of intensive intelligence and military preparations, executed through a combination of vehicle infiltrations and aerial cover provided by drones that had been monitoring and tracking the region for weeks. Israeli forces used vehicles, weapons, and motorcycles to quickly and safely transfer al-Arabiid, accompanied by dense aerial surveillance. The operation repeated the scenario of infiltrating via the new route along the Nitzariim axis, which Israel had seized during the war. This operation represents a development in Israel's intelligence methods and fieldwork tactics, relying on strong intelligence coverage and precise monitoring, and it resulted in subsequent arrests of individuals collaborating with Israel within the Gaza Strip.
